Mirpur - Raghogarh, Guna
Mirpur is a village situated in the Raghogarh tehsil of Guna district, Madhya Pradesh. It is located approximately 9 km from the tehsil headquarters in Raghogarh and around 47 km from the district headquarters in Guna. Nohar serves as the Gram Panchayat for Mirpur village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Mirpur is 499270. The village covers a total geographical area of 157 hectares and falls under the 473226 pincode. Raghogarh is the nearest town, located about 9 km away.
Mirpur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Raghogarh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Rajgarh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Mirpur
As per Census 2011, Mirpur village has a total population of 453 people, consisting of 232 males and 221 females. The village has 91 households and a sex ratio of 952 females per 1,000 males. There are 90 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 152 literate and 301 illiterate residents.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Mirpur are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 453 | 232 | 221 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 90 | 50 | 40 |
| Literate Population | 152 | 89 | 63 |
| Illiterate Population | 301 | 143 | 158 |

Transport and Connectivity of Mirpur
Mirpur is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Raghogarh to Mirpur is about 9 km, with a usual travel time of around 15-30 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Guna to Mirpur is about 47 km, with the usual travel time around ~1.3 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
